What did Sondland say during the hearing?

During the hearing, Sondland undercut a key Trump defense and simultaneously confirmed a claim from the whistleblower complaint that triggered the impeachment inquiry. Zelensky “had to announce the investigations,” Sondland said, referring to the probes into Biden’s family and the 2016 election.

Who did Sondland implicate in the investigation?

Sondland implicated Pence, Pompeo and Mulvaney. Republicans have argued that Giuliani could have been running a shadow foreign policy without the involvement or knowledge of other senior White House and State Department officials, but Sondland contradicted that several times in his testimony. What company did Sondland investigate?

Sondland recounted several conversations between himself and Trump about Ukraine opening two investigations: one into Burisma, a company where former Vice President Joe Biden’s son was on the board, and another into conspiracies about Ukrainian meddling in the 2016 US election.

Who told Pence he had concerns about the delay in military aid?

Sondland also testified that he had told Pence he had “concerns that the delay in (military) aid had become tied to the issue of investigations” before Pence had a meeting with Zelensky in Warsaw, Poland, on September 1, implying Pence was aware of the “investigations” in the first place.

Did Sondland say he knew Trump wanted to investigate the Bidens?

Under aggressive questioning from Democrats, Sondland refused to say he realized that Trump was asking Ukraine to investigate the Bidens. He wouldn’t go there. Instead, he said he knew only that Trump and Giuliani wanted Zelensky to probe Burisma.
